Roddy McDowall (1928-1998) English-American actor, voice artist and film director.  His career lasted an amazing 60 years. His IMDb page shows 262 acting credits from 1938-1999. This page will rank 65 Roddy McDowall movies from Best to Worst in six different sortable columns of information. His many television appearances, his early British movies, his Monogram movies and movies not released in North American theaters  were not were not included in the rankings. Possibly Interesting Facts About Roddy McDowall

1. Roderick Andrew Anthony Jude McDowall was born in Herne Hill, London in 1928.

2.  Roddy McDowall was a child model as a baby.  At the age of 10 he was already appearing in movies….he would remain making movies the rest of his life.

3.  Roddy McDowall was lifelong friends with Elizabeth Taylor. They both starred in 1943’s Lassie Come Home. Taylor referred to him as the one friend she had to whom she confided everything, and who was always understanding.

4.  Roddy McDowall was never nominated for an Oscar®.  He did receive a Best Supporting Golden Globe® nomination for 1963’s Cleopatra.

5.  A clerical error on the part of 20th Century-Fox cost Roddy McDowall a likely Oscar® nomination for Best Supporting Actor for his role as Caesar Augustus Octavian in 1963’s Cleopatra. The studio erroneously listed him as a leading player rather than a supporting one. When 20th Century-Fox asked the Academy to correct the error, it refused, saying the ballots already were at the printer.

6.  Roddy McDowall was never married and did not have any children.

7.  In 1974, the FBI raided Roddy McDowall’s home and seized his collection of films and television series in the course of an investigation into film piracy and copyright infringement. His collection consisted of 160 16-mm prints and more than 1,000 video cassettes, at a time before the era of commercial videotapes, when there was no legal aftermarket for films. McDowall had purchased Errol Flynn’s home cinema films and transferred them all to tape for longer-lasting archival storage. No charges were filed.

8.  Roddy McDowall played the chimpanzee archaeologist Cornelius in 4 of the first 5 Planet of the Apes movies. He did not appear in 1970’s Beneath the Planet of the Apes.
